Transaction 7231ee881bda36f68ad249414a40bcb9f7b646c05243b63e10f32c056fcb38f7

1 Input
2 Outputs
  • 7231ee881bda36f68ad249414a40bcb9f7b646c05243b63e10f32c056fcb38f7:0
  • value  5000000
    address  2N5iJpuMSstQmHsKiac3AFJCcjspWKcfM2M
  • 7231ee881bda36f68ad249414a40bcb9f7b646c05243b63e10f32c056fcb38f7:1
  • value  20679642
    address  2MuwgYtqeDL9hxcW2iGbo4eEmCREknL8nMa